SQQQ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2014 in Review

13 of the 3,749 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ProShares UltraPro Short QQQ (SQQQ) for Q4 2014, worth a combined $9.93M — up 12% from $8.87M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 7 funds opened new SQQQ positions and 5 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 4 added to existing stakes and 1 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Tower Research Capital (TRC), adding an estimated $2.64M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.32M sold.
